Foundation Damage Repair Services
Foundation damage repair involves identifying and addressing issues that compromise the stability of a building’s foundation. This process typically includes assessing the extent of damage, such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and then implementing appropriate solutions to restore structural integrity. Common rep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or mudjacking, depending on the severity and type of foundation problem.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further deterioration, and ensure the safety and longevity of the property.
These services help resolve a variety of foundation-related problems that can impact property value, safety, and usability. Signs of damage often include uneven flooring, cracked wal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line. Foundation damage repair also helps mitigate issues caused by soil movement, moisture intrusion, or poor construction practices, which can lead to significant structural concerns if left unaddressed.
Properties that typically require foundation damage repair services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or shifting soils,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Older structures may be more prone to foundation issues due to aging materials and construction methods. Additionally, properties located in areas with high moisture levels, frequent freeze-thaw cycles, or significant soil movement are more likely to need foundation stabilization or repair services to maintain their structural integrity.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Arlington County,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000 to $3,000, while major repairs could exceed $10,000 in some cases.
Repair Method Expenses - The method used to address foundation issues influences costs, with underpinning or piering services generally falling between $3,000 and $10,000. More complex solutions, such as foundation replacement, can increase costs significantly beyond this range.
Location and Soil Factors - Costs may vary based on local soil conditions and geographic location, with repairs in Arlington County, VA, typically ranging from $3,500 to $8,000. Soil-related challenges can add to the overall expense of foundation stabilization.
Inspection and Consultation Fees - Professional assessments for foundation damage usually cost between $200 and $600, which are often deductible from the total repair costs if work proceeds. These inspections help determine the scope and necessary repair methods.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.
How do professionals assess foundation damage? They typically perform visual inspections, evaluate structural movement, and may use specialized tools to identify underlying issues.
What repair options are available for foundation damage? Repair methods can include underpinning, slab jacking, wall stabilization, or piering, depending on the severity and type of damage.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age and the chosen repair method, with some projects completing within a few days to a week.
Why is timely repair important for foundation issues? Addressing foundation problems promptly can prevent further structural damage, reduce repair costs, and maintain property stability.
